Thanks to visit codestin.com
Credit goes to github.com

Skip to content

Releases: aelassas/servy

Servy 2.5

23 Oct 09:24

Choose a tag to compare

  • fix(service): correctly display non-ASCII characters in stdout/stderr (#20)
  • fix(recovery): allow graceful restart

Servy 2.4

21 Oct 19:57

Choose a tag to compare

  • fix(service): incorrect process termination (#20)
  • fix(logging): add Event ID to Info, Warning, and Error service logs
  • fix(core): ensure PID is preserved after importing a running service
  • fix(core): exclude service Id and PID from XML and JSON exports
  • ci(sonar): add SonarCloud analysis workflow
  • ci(release): add release workflow
  • refactor: general refactoring and code cleanup

Servy 2.3

13 Oct 18:07

Choose a tag to compare

  • fix(security): add debug logging option and prevent sensitive data exposure (#19)
  • fix(psm1): handle parameters correctly in PowerShell module to avoid argument misparsing (#18)
  • fix(cli): correct help text for environment variables
  • fix(packaging): include PowerShell module in portable ZIP
  • docs(psm1): update documentation and examples for PowerShell module
  • chore: resolve false positives in SecureAge and Gridinsoft

Servy 2.2

09 Oct 22:29

Choose a tag to compare

  • feat(manager): enhance DataGrid virtualization and performance
  • fix(manager): prevent resizing DataGrid rows
  • fix(service): service install not working when Windows is installed on a drive letter other than C: #16
  • fix(service): reorganize and clean up startup parameters log

Servy 2.1

09 Oct 04:45

Choose a tag to compare

  • fix(clients): Servy.Service.exe not copied when Windows is installed on a drive letter other than C: #16
  • fix(clients): load appsettings.json from project root in debug and exe directory in release #16
  • fix(configurator): export XML and JSON not working when password is supplied

Servy 2.0

07 Oct 21:13

Choose a tag to compare

  • fix(clients): prevent loading stray appsettings.json at runtime #16
  • fix(core): robust and accurate CPU usage calculation
  • fix(service): avoid stopping services when copying Servy.Restarter.exe from resources
  • fix(service): add missing log for post-launch options

Servy 1.9

04 Oct 07:32

Choose a tag to compare

  • fix(manager): adjust service list column widths when maximizing window
  • chore(release): add generic installer
  • chore: update dependencies

Servy 1.8

01 Oct 03:47
d7863e3

Choose a tag to compare

  • fix(core): using the same file for stdout and stderr prevents log rotation #14
  • fix(installer): manager and cli apps not killed on uninstall
  • fix(core): use ConcurrentDictionary for thread-safe CPU usage tracking of services
  • fix(core): prevent NullReferenceException in CPU usage retrieval
  • fix(core): optimize resource copying for better performance
  • fix(manager): escape \, % and _ in services search to match literals
  • fix(manager): lower services refresh interval to 4 seconds
  • fix(manager): enforce blue background and white text for selected DataGrid rows
  • chore(installer): fix false positives in VirusTotal, Microsoft Defender, SecureAge, and Zillya
  • chore(installer): add Servy to Scoop extras bucket

Servy 1.7

29 Sep 06:17
ff17b78

Choose a tag to compare

  • feat(manager): add real-time CPU & RAM monitoring for services
  • feat(manager): add PID column and Copy PID action to services
  • fix(core): optimize resource copying for better performance
  • fix(core): reliably update service without checking Win32 error
  • fix(manager): performance issues on UI thread when loading and updating services
  • fix(manager): adjust actions column width in services
  • fix(manager): load configuration from appsettings.manager.json
  • fix(configurator): load configuration from appsettings.json
  • fix(cli): load configuration from appsettings.cli.json
  • fix(cli): correct help text for --preLaunchEnv argument in install command
  • chore: update dependencies

Servy 1.6

23 Sep 13:53

Choose a tag to compare

  • feat(core): add support for post-launch actions
  • feat(installer): add Servy to Scoop package manager
  • fix(configurator): increase tab height for better visibility
  • fix(installer): adjust LZMA dictionary size to 64MB to reduce memory usage during install